Understanding Solitary Animals

Solitary animals are species that prefer to live alone rather than in groups. This behavior can be attributed to various evolutionary advantages, including reduced competition for resources, increased personal space, and decreased risk of disease transmission. Some of the most well-known solitary animals include the tiger, the polar bear, and the giant panda.

The Evolution of Solitary Living

The evolution of solitary living is a complex process shaped by environmental factors and survival needs. Animals that have evolved in isolated or resource-scarce environments often develop solitary habits. For instance, the tiger’s large territory ensures it has enough prey to sustain itself, while the polar bear’s vast Arctic habitat requires it to cover great distances in search of food.

Adaptations of Solitary Animals

Solitary animals exhibit a range of fascinating adaptations that allow them to thrive alone in the wild. These adaptations can be physical, behavioral, or physiological, each serving a specific purpose in the survival of the species.

Physical Adaptations

Many solitary animals possess physical traits that enhance their ability to hunt and defend themselves. For example, the tiger has powerful muscles and retractable claws, making it an efficient predator. Similarly, the polar bear’s thick fur and layer of fat enable it to withstand harsh Arctic temperatures while hunting seals alone.

Behavioral Adaptations

Behavioral adaptations are equally critical for solitary animals. These species often develop specialized hunting strategies to maximize their chances of success. For instance, solitary hunters like the owl rely on stealth and acute hearing to locate prey in the dark. In contrast, the giant panda primarily feeds on bamboo, which requires a significant amount of time and energy to consume, emphasizing the importance of a solitary lifestyle in resource management.

Social Interactions Among Solitary Animals

While solitary animals primarily live alone, they are not completely devoid of social interactions. These creatures may engage in social behaviors during mating seasons or when rearing young. Understanding these interactions provides insight into their complex lives.

Mating Behaviors

Mating among solitary animals often involves elaborate courtship rituals. For example, male tigers will roar to establish territory and attract females. Once a female is receptive, the male will engage in mating behaviors, but afterward, they typically go their separate ways, highlighting the transient nature of their social interactions.

Parenting and Offspring Care

In many solitary species, mothers often take on the sole responsibility of raising their young. The female polar bear, for instance, will fiercely protect her cubs until they are mature enough to fend for themselves. This solitary approach to parenting ensures that the mother can focus on the survival of her offspring without the distraction of a mate.

Examples of Solitary Animals

Several species exemplify the solitary lifestyle, each with its unique characteristics and adaptations. Here are a few notable examples:

Tigers

Tigers are the largest members of the cat family and are known for their solitary hunting methods. They use their excellent camouflage and stealth to stalk prey, relying on their strength and agility to make a successful kill.

Polar Bears

Polar bears are solitary creatures that roam the Arctic in search of food. They are highly skilled hunters, primarily feeding on seals. Their solitary nature allows them to cover vast distances in search of food sources.

Giant Pandas

Giant pandas primarily feed on bamboo and are known for their solitary habits. While they may occasionally interact with one another, they spend most of their lives alone, relying on their keen sense of smell to locate mates during the breeding season.

The Importance of Solitary Animals in Ecosystems

Solitary animals play a vital role in maintaining ecological balance. As apex predators, they help regulate prey populations, ensuring a healthy ecosystem. Their solitary behaviors also contribute to biodiversity, as each species occupies a unique niche within its habitat.

Conservation Challenges

Despite their fascinating adaptations, many solitary animals face significant threats due to habitat loss, poaching, and climate change. Conservation efforts are essential to ensure these species continue to thrive in the wild. Protecting their habitats and promoting awareness of their ecological roles is crucial for their survival.
